compiling with gcov flags -fprofile-arcs and -ftest-coverage fails.


Hi,

I am trying to compile a big C++ project with fprofile-arcs and ftest-coverage. When linking I am getting error:
archive-name.a(object.o) : (.ctors+0x0): undefined reference to `global constructors keyed to ZN107_GLOBAL__N__long_path_of_cpp_file_00000000_FD31D6232_1E'

I am compiling with -fprofile-arcs and -ftest-coverage.
I am linking objects with -fprofile-arcs and ftest-covearge and -lgcov.

I don't know where I am doing wrong. Can anyone help me sort out this problem. Actually I googled a lot on this issue but without any success.
